Transaction 836be7886868a03b2409157b1c8e3292f20fcb64c89eb64e776c78c35f56e914
1 Input
1 Output
-
836be7886868a03b2409157b1c8e3292f20fcb64c89eb64e776c78c35f56e914:0
- value
- 8701577
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ed556c46477e868a456403b6ae1c1989ae4ce2b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16jETwfaACpVMbytxCoNnt7AWomRo5Cwww